Quote: The Significance of Translating the Puns in Shakespeare’s Sonnets

Pun is an important rhetoric device in literature. It is especially popular in the Elizabeth Age. William Shakespeare was a great punster, and he made a lot of puns in his sonnets. The objective of this paper is to call readers’ and translators’ attention that the puns should be given appropriate attention. This paper finds that puns are significant play a very important role in Shakespeare’s Sonnets, and that puns were not given appropriate attention in the Chinese translation. Without understanding the puns, one can never fully understand the sonnets. Poetry is difficult to translate, and puns make it more difficult. However, translating the sonnets without translating the puns is only a half translation.
